Puerto Rican towns sue major oil companies, alleging suppression of climate science

Summary by Ground News
16 Puerto Rico municipalities filed a class-action lawsuit in federal court against major oil companies. The lawsuit alleges companies like ExxonMobil, Shell and Chevron colluded to suppress evidence of climate change that has devastated the island. The defendants produced just over 40 percent of global industrial greenhouse gas emissions between 1965 and 2017, the lawsuit alleges.
